cho dãy gồm 8 bóng đèn nằm ngang được đánh số bắt đầu từ 0đến 7 theo chiều từ 0,3,5 đều sáng còn lại tắt thì làm thế nào để biểu diễn trạng thái của 8 bóng đèn để đưa vào máy tính trong trường hợp đó

2 câu trả lời

Để dưa vào máy tính biểu diễn, ta sẽ lưu một mảng giá trị Boolean (Gồm 2 giá trị là đúng - biểu diễn cho đèn đang sáng, và sai - biểu diễn cho đèn tắt).

Ta sẽ lưu vào một mảng a và gán các giá trị như sau:

a[0] = true;

a[3] = true;

a[5] = true;

Còn các giá trị a[i] còn lại gán bằng false;

Trong C++ ,ta có thể khai báo một mảng lưu trạng thái của 8 bón đèn như sau:

bool a[8] = {1, 0, 0, 1, 0, 1, 0, 0}.

Có thể biểu diễn bằng một mảng boolean (true/false)

Hoặc một mảng gồm 1/0 (biểu diễn thay cho true/false)